Transaction 23f028177e85dc79493f6b96daf899e2aa1944f9632a7c289d937451d15a4f9b
1 Input
1 Output
-
23f028177e85dc79493f6b96daf899e2aa1944f9632a7c289d937451d15a4f9b:0
- value
- 767929
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33cb3d124a0669fad51546fa3c612d26f511f920 OP_EQUAL
- address
- 36QsrbAUFi5DDsVJWRSYtG1rz1jHfLMfpn